The term marked the trade path that linked the ancient Rome with China. Nowadays the term \u201csilk road\u201d is used to mark all the roads that were used for trade between East and Europe.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">In addition to silk, a wide range of other goods was traded along the Silk Road, and the network was also important for migrants and travelers, and for the <\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">spread of religion<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, philosophy, science, technology and artistic ideals. From the East the Silk Road passed through Armenia, or rather, through the Artashat city and from there stretched to the harbors of the Black Sea. In the 5th century Dvin came to replace Artashat as the capital of Armenia. The trade road that linked China, Central Asia and Iran with the capital of Byzantine Empire Constantinople passed through Dvin. <\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The Silk Road \u00a0from Armenia through the \u2018Stans\u2019 to China, was a little known trading route until it was discovered by Marco Polo in the 13th century. Later many samples of Persian pottery, silk and china were found during the excavations in Ani. <\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Till now in Vayots Dzor Province of Armenia the ancient Orbelians&#8217; caravanserai was preserved, which once served as an inn for traders who passed through Armenia along the Silk Toad. <\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The Great Silk Road played a great role between the East and the West.
